The MoPod is an interview style podcast brought to you by MoDate. Hosted by Evan Harris, the founder of MoDate, the MoPod dives into all topics surrounding Judaism and gives people an outlet to discuss their journeys through life and what they hope to achieve whether that be in the world of dating, entrepreneurship, sports, religious growth, or a variety of other topics.
